TUESDAY MAY 18th - FLOWER DEMONSTRATION 1.30-4.30 pm.

Final year level four Kingston Maurward students, together with their tutor are coming to support the garden , completing five demonstrations on the theme of Spring/ early Summer . Tickets are £5.00 to include tea and cake with a raffle for the demonstrations. Numbers are strictly limited and we are operating under safe covid requirements.40 seats are taken and we have capacity for just 10 more. MAY 22nd 10-1 pm- MASS PLANT OUT

This is the day we will be planting out the seeds grown, finishing off troughs and any other planting which arises, plus put- ting out the art club plant identification signs . Again - there will be cakes and take away style coffee.

We will have a planting plan and would welcome as many of the seed growers who would like to come and plant as pos- sible please. I dont anticipate people having to be there for three hours - it is just a drop in, plant and go...although any- one is very welcome to stay as long as they want. This is also open to any villagers who would like to come along to sup- port the growing- we would welcome any help with the fun part of the planting. The planting in the garden will be intensive cut flower gardening style - so lots of potential future blooms to plant out to give us plenty of flowers.

JUNE 26th GRAND OPENING 1-4 pm

This is going to be a lovely event with live music from Clayesmore, country dancing from Steps in Time and potentially more live music at the end of the afternoon. John Crompton is running a BBQ and bar. We have a grand raffle- there are some fabulous prizes pledged already and we will be selling tickets very soon. Sue is running a friendship bracelet stand, we will have flower posies - jars of joy” , plus a cake stall and the chance to be together.
